The striated microfilament bundles had electron dense
cross bands with a periodicity of approximately 200 nm, and
attached to the membrane with almost right angle (90◦) at the
cross band level (Figs. 1 and 3). At the terminal of the bundle,
the cross band seemed to bridge with the electron dense layer
just beneath the membrane (Fig. 3). In some cases, the bundles
were bent and branched (Fig. 2). No relation between the
bundle and centrioles was observed, as far as we could see.
